Re: HD Size Limit on RamFAST?



Terry & Utahna <tolsen64@hotmail.com> wrote:
> Is there a Hard drive size limit that RamFast will handle?  I have a 20MB &
> 80MB drive and they work fine.  I have a 2GB Drive and it doesn't.  The
> RamFast utils can format & partition it and it comes up with 12 32MB
> partitions, but they don't appear in the list to map to slots.  The first
> partition does but prodos doesn't see it.  When I boot into GSOS, I can then
> format it as one big 2GB HFS partition and it works fine there.  I've even
> tried deleting all partitions except the first 32MB partition, but Prodos
> still won't recognize it.  Just for the heck of it, I created an 8MB
> partition but still nothing...anyone got any ideas?


FWIW, I wasn't able to get a 2GB drive to work either.  I switched to
an Apple HS SCSI card, and everything worked fine.
